6 Music at the Southbank Centre - Event Highlights

Cerys Matthews, Jarvis Cocker, Steve Lamacq and more 6 Music stars introduce live performances from a bunch of our musical pals recorded at London's Southbank Centre on Friday 16 March 2012.

In the Queen Elizabeth Hall, the innovative and influential Public Image Ltd. perform their first live show of the year. Super Furry Animals frontman Gruff Rhys showcases his own peculiar brand of skewed pop, and Anna Calvi is right at home with her magnificent operatic sound.

Beth Jeans Houghton & The Hooves of Destiny also bring their off-kilter grandeur to proceedings, while Blur guitarist Graham Coxon completes the line-up, showcasing tracks from his new album.

Next door, twice Mercury-nominated Laura Marling brings her beautiful, brittle songcraft to the Purcell Room, which also plays host to newcomer Lianne La Havas, who was recently given the nod in the 主播大秀's Sound of 2012 list.
